No snap GE, PM tells Dewan; Azalina refers FOI Bill to PSSC

 


GE16

  • Prime Minister Anwar Ibrahim has dismissed speculation of a snap general election, warning all parties against overconfidence.

    In response to a question from Rosol Wahid (PN-Hulu Terengganu), Anwar expressed his belief that voters wanted stability and economic growth, not mere politicking.

    “Give us the time we have to fulfil our mandate until the next election - then we can fight it out. I have no problem with that.

    “I don’t want to be overconfident, and I don’t think Hulu Terengganu should be too confident either,” he told the Dewan Rakyat today.

    Rosol had asked whether Anwar was mulling a parliamentary dissolution to make way for an election, claiming this would “ensure” economic and political stability.

FOI Bill

  • Minister in the Prime Minister’s Department (Law and Institutional Reform) Azalina Othman Said has referred the Freedom of Information Bill 2026 to a parliamentary special select committee. She tabled a motion in the Dewan Rakyat this afternoon, supported by her deputy, M Kulasegaran.

    The committee will propose any necessary amendments to the bill within the next three months, which may be extended if needed, she said.

    This follows extensive pushback from civil society organisations and the Malaysian Media Council as the bill restricts access to information and preserves the controversial Official Secrets Act 1972. - Mkini
